From dc10c40578e413651b4ccd2447ed7d00f9bae9fd Mon Sep 17 00:00:00 2001 From: Elmon11 Date: Sun, 21 Mar 2021 13:57:24 +0100 Subject: [PATCH] noclear option in smite --- .../totalfreedommod/command/Command_smite.java | 9 ++++++--- 1 file changed, 6 insertions(+), 3 deletions(-) diff --git a/src/main/java/me/totalfreedom/totalfreedommod/command/Command_smite.java b/src/main/java/me/totalfreedom/totalfreedommod/command/Command_smite.java index 708d36bf..b82921cd 100644 --- a/src/main/java/me/totalfreedom/totalfreedommod/command/Command_smite.java +++ b/src/main/java/me/totalfreedom/totalfreedommod/command/Command_smite.java @@ -15,7 +15,7 @@ import org.bukkit.command.CommandSender; import org.bukkit.entity.Player; @CommandPermissions(level = Rank.ADMIN, source = SourceType.BOTH) -@CommandParameters(description = "Someone being a little bitch? Smite them down...", usage = "/ [reason] [-q]") +@CommandParameters(description = "Someone being a little bitch? Smite them down...", usage = "/ [reason] [-nc | -q]") public class Command_smite extends FreedomCommand { @@ -54,7 +54,10 @@ public class Command_smite extends FreedomCommand player.setGameMode(GameMode.SURVIVAL); // Clear inventory - player.getInventory().clear(); + if (!args[args.length - 1].equalsIgnoreCase("-nc")) + { + player.getInventory().clear(); + } // Strike with lightning effect final Location targetPos = player.getLocation(); @@ -122,4 +125,4 @@ public class Command_smite extends FreedomCommand return true; } -} \ No newline at end of file +}